Photograph of iceboxes made by the Copeland Company and washing machines made by the Dexter Co. Setting is inside a large tent, possibly the Shenandoah County Fair.

The display was sponsored by People's Hardware Corp. in Harrisonburg, Va.

Photograph of the girls' dormitory of the Shenandoah Valley Academy. In the school's 1940 Yearbook this structure is named Elliott Hall.

Shenandoah Valley Academy is a private school in New Market, Virginia run by the Seventh Day Adventists.
